Friday April 7th, 2006. This is show # 70.

BEST QUOTE OF THE SHOW
You see principals who say, "We don't want you kids dressing a certain way because of the tension in the school" and the conservative parents are up in arms: "My kid has a right to wear whatever he wants to wear." And so he teaches his little bra...his little kid to disrespect the adults around him and those in authority.
Summary:
* Today the Enyart's watched three young granddaughters completely disrespect their grandma at McDonald's.
* A Republican Attorney General and the ACLU force school principle to cave in to the clothing choices of eleven and twelve year olds, yet again undermining adult authority over children.
* Colorado State Commissioner of Education encourages a large crowd of conservative Christians during the annual Homeschool Day at the Capitol.
* Recap of the KGOV Immigration Solution.
* Linda Brake from CRTL announces Colorado Right To Life's April 29 High School Oratory Contest for Juniors and Seniors with scholarship awards including $500 to the first place contestant!
* End Times fixation leads many Christians to force an interpretation of current events as fulfillment of prophecy.
* The Plot endorsements from the back cover read on air for the first time in... forever?
* What thoughts do you have if a Mexican "takes" an American's job? Make sure those thoughts do not include envy or bitterness, and remember that Jesus said the second greatest command is to love your neighbor as yourself!
